diff --git a/amixer/amixer.c b/amixer/amixer.c index f822ba3..d4a59e6 100644 --- a/amixer/amixer.c +++ b/amixer/amixer.c @@ -1486,7 +1486,7 @@ int main(int argc, char *argv[]) break; case 'D': case HELPID_DEVICE: - strncpy(card, optarg, sizeof(card-1)); + strncpy(card, optarg, sizeof(card)-1); card[sizeof(card)-1] = '\0'; break; case 'q':